[17/21] target/microblaze: Move setting of float rounding mode to reset

Although the floating point rounding mode for Microblaze is always
nearest-even, we cannot set it just once in the CPU initfn.  This is
because env->fp_status is in the part of the CPU state struct that is
zeroed on reset.

Move the call to set_float_rounding_mode() into the reset fn.

(This had no guest-visible effects because it happens that the
float_round_nearest_even enum value is 0, so when the struct was
zeroed it didn't corrupt the setting.)
